Part 1. Can You Delete Your YouTube Music Account?

Before deleting your YouTube Music account, it is important to understand how YouTube Music works. YouTube Music does not have a separate account system. It is connected to your Google Account, which means you cannot delete only your YouTube Music profile while keeping the same Google Account active.

If you want to stop using YouTube Music, you have several options depending on your needs. You can cancel your YouTube Music Premium subscription, remove your account from a device, clear your listening history and personal data, or permanently delete your entire Google Account.

Before you delete anything, make sure you understand what will happen. Removing YouTube Music data may delete your playlists, likes, downloads, recommendations, and listening history. If you have saved important songs or created personal playlists, consider backing them up first.

Important Things to Know Before You Delete
  • Connection Between YouTube Music and Google Account: Deleting your Google Account will also remove access to other Google services, such as Gmail, YouTube, Google Drive, and Google Photos.
  • YouTube Music Premium Cancellation Not Deleting Your Account: You can still use YouTube Music with ads after your subscription ends.
  • Removed Downloaded Songs by Premium Cancellation or Deleted Account: Make sure to save any music you want to keep before taking action.
  • Unrecoverable Playlists and Music Preferences: Once YouTube Music data is removed, your recommendations, likes, and history may be permanently lost.
  • Remove Your Account from a Device for Device Switches: If you are switching phones or computers, signing out or removing the account may be enough, rather than deleting it completely.

Understanding these differences can help you choose the right method and avoid accidentally losing your favorite music or other Google data.

Part 2. How to Delete Your YouTube Music Data

Since YouTube Music is tied to your Google Account, there isn't a single button that deletes only your YouTube Music account. Instead, you can choose the method that best fits your demand.

You can cancel your subscription if you only want to stop paying for Premium. If you are switching devices, remove your account from that device. For a fresh start, you can clear your listening history and activity. Choose the method in part 3 to permanently delete your Google Account if you do not need any Google services.

Method 1: Cancel Your YouTube Music Premium Subscription

Canceling YouTube Music Premium ends future billing but does not delete your account or playlists. When your paid time ends, you can access YouTube Music as a Free-tier user.

On Android

01Launch the YouTube Music app on your phone.
02Tap your profile picture in the top-right corner.
03Select Paid memberships from the menu.
04Tap on your active YouTube Music Premium plan.
05Tap Deactivate, then select Continue to cancel.
06Pick your reason for leaving, tap Next, and hit Yes, cancel to confirm.

On iOS

If you signed up through Apple, you need to cancel via the device settings instead of the YouTube app.

01Launch the Settings app on your iOS device.
02Tap your name/Apple ID at the very top of the screen.
03Tap Subscriptions.
04Select YouTube Music Premium from your list of active services.
05Tap Cancel Subscription and confirm your choice.

On Desktop

01Go to music.youtube.com and sign in to your account.
02Click your profile picture in the top-right corner.
03Click Paid memberships, then select Manage membership.
04Click the Deactivate button.
05Click Continue to cancel and follow the final prompt to confirm.

Method 2: Remove Your Account from Your Device

If you no longer want to use YouTube Music on a specific device, you can remove your Google Account from that device. This logs you out without deleting your data or harming your Google Account.

On Android

01Launch the main Settings app on your phone or tablet.
02Scroll down and tap Passwords & accounts or just Accounts, depending on your device.
03Tap the Google Account you want to remove.
04Tap the Remove account button.
05Verify your choice if prompted by your device.

On iOS

01Launch the YouTube Music app.
02Tap your profile picture in the top-right corner.
03Tap Switch account from the menu.
04Select Manage accounts on this device.
05Tap Remove from this device next to the Google Account you want to sign out of.

On Desktop

01Open any web browser you prefer on the desktop.
02Navigate to the YouTube Music website, and it usually be signed in automatically.
03Click your profile picture.
04Click Sign Out.

Method 3: Clear Your Music History & Data

If you want to erase your listening activity instead of deleting your account, you can clear your YouTube Music history and activity.

On Mobile & Desktop

01Open the YouTube Music app or the website.
02Sign in to your Google Account.
03Click or tap your profile picture.
04Open Settings.
05Select Privacy & location.
06Choose Manage watch history.
07Delete your history by selecting Delete today, Delete custom range, or Delete all time.

Delete today: Erases only the music you played today.

Delete custom range: Lets you pick a specific timeframe to wipe.

Delete all time: Permanently clears your entire history from day one.

You can also pause your watch and search history to prevent YouTube Music from saving future activity.

Part 3. How to Delete Your YouTube Music Account Permanently

If you no longer want to use any Google services, you can permanently delete your Google Account. This removes your YouTube Music account along with Gmail, YouTube, Google Drive, Google Photos, Google Calendar, and other Google services associated with that account.

This move is permanent. Once your Google Account is deleted, you will not recover your data.

Delete the Google Account Permanently

01Open a web browser and go to myaccount.google.com.

02Sign in to your Google Account.

03Click Data & Privacy.

04Scroll to More options.

05Click Delete your Google Account.

06Verify your identity by entering your password.

07Read the information about what will be deleted.

08Check the confirmation boxes.

09Click Delete Account to permanently remove your Google Account.

Once the process is complete, your YouTube Music account and all associated Google services will be deleted permanently.
